Abstract

Disclosed in the present invention are a WiFi hotspot-based network sharing method and apparatus. The method comprises the steps of: imposing a usage restriction condition on an access device; and if an access device accessing a WiFi hotspot meets the usage restriction condition, disconnecting the connection of the access device to the WiFi hotspot. Thus, by imposing a usage restriction condition for each access device, the present invention achieves independent management and control on respective access devices during network sharing, and improves controllability of network sharing for the devices, thereby facilitating reasonable and efficient use of the shared network, increasing network utilization efficiency, and improving user experience.

现有的移动终端具有网络分享功能,当用户有较多的网络流量剩余时,可以开启wifi热点,允许其它终端接入wifi热点,分享自己剩余的网络流量。但是,如果用户开启wifi热点后忘记关闭,就会造成很大的流量损耗,从而为用户带来巨额的流量费用损失。The existing mobile terminal has a network sharing function. When the user has more network traffic remaining, the wifi hotspot can be turned on, allowing other terminals to access the wifi hotspot and share the remaining network traffic. However, if the user forgets to turn off after turning on the wifi hotspot, it will cause a large flow loss, which will bring huge traffic cost loss to the user.
为了解决上述问题,现有技术提出了一种解决方案,在开启wifi热点时,设置最大分享流量,一旦分享流量达到最大分享流量时,则关闭wifi热点,从而在总体上对流量进行了控制,避免了用户预期之外的流量消耗,有效控制了流量费用。In order to solve the above problem, the prior art proposes a solution, when the wifi hotspot is turned on, the maximum shared traffic is set, and once the shared traffic reaches the maximum shared traffic, the wifi hotspot is turned off, thereby controlling the traffic overall. It avoids the traffic consumption beyond the user's expectations and effectively controls the traffic charges.
然而,在网络分享过程中,接入wifi热点的接入设备的使用情况各不相同,有的用户可能使用接入设备下载大容量文件或者观看大流量视频,导致分享流量很快耗尽,影响了其他用户的正常使用。因此,现有的移动终端对网络分享的可控性差,使得分享的网络不能得到合理和有效的使用。However, in the network sharing process, the access devices accessing the wifi hotspots are different in use. Some users may use the access device to download large-capacity files or watch large-traffic videos, resulting in the quickly exhausted sharing traffic. The normal use of other users. Therefore, the existing mobile terminal has poor controllability for network sharing, so that the shared network cannot be used reasonably and effectively.

S12、判断接入无线热点的接入设备是否达到使用限制条件。当达到使用限制条件时,执行步骤S13。S12. Determine whether the access device accessing the wireless hotspot meets the use restriction condition. When the use restriction condition is reached, step S13 is performed.
在网络分享过程中,实时或定时的监控各接入设备的使用情况,判断各接入设备是否达到其使用限制条件。During the network sharing process, the usage of each access device is monitored in real time or periodically, and it is determined whether each access device meets its usage restriction condition.
S13、断开接入设备与无线热点的连接。 S13. Disconnect the access device from the wireless hotspot.
当某个接入设备达到其使用限制条件时,则断开该接入设备与无线热点的连接,禁止该接入设备继续分享网络。When an access device reaches its usage restriction condition, the connection between the access device and the wireless hotspot is disconnected, and the access device is prohibited from continuing to share the network.
优选地,当使用限制条件为最大使用流量时,监控接入设备的使用流量,当接入设备的使用流量达到最大使用流量时,断开接入设备与无线热点的连接。当使用限制条件为最大使用时长时,监控接入设备的使用时间,当接入设备的使用时间达到最大使用时长时,断开接入设备与无线热点的连接。当使用限制条件为网站访问黑名单时,监控接入设备访问的网站,当接入设备访问黑名单上的网站时,断开接入设备与无线热点的连接。Preferably, when the usage restriction condition is the maximum usage traffic, the usage traffic of the access device is monitored, and when the usage traffic of the access device reaches the maximum usage traffic, the connection between the access device and the wireless hotspot is disconnected. When the usage limit is the maximum usage duration, the usage time of the access device is monitored, and when the usage time of the access device reaches the maximum usage duration, the connection between the access device and the wireless hotspot is disconnected. When the use of the restriction condition is that the website accesses the blacklist, the website accessed by the access device is monitored, and when the access device accesses the website on the blacklist, the connection between the access device and the wireless hotspot is disconnected.
可选地,还可以在开启无线热点之前或之后,对无线热点设置分享限制条件。在网络分享过程中,监控网络分享情况,当达到分享限制条件时,则关闭无线热点,不再分享网络。Optionally, a sharing restriction condition may be set for the wireless hotspot before or after the wireless hotspot is turned on. During the network sharing process, the network sharing situation is monitored. When the sharing restriction condition is reached, the wireless hotspot is turned off and the network is no longer shared.
该分享限制条件包括最大分享流量、最大分享时长等。当网络分享流量达到最大分享流量时,则关闭无线热点;当网络分享时长达到最大分享时长时,则关闭无线热点。从而在整体上对网络分享进行管理和控制,防止分享超额而给用户带来损失。The sharing restrictions include maximum sharing traffic, maximum sharing duration, and more. When the network sharing traffic reaches the maximum shared traffic, the wireless hotspot is turned off; when the network sharing time reaches the maximum sharing duration, the wireless hotspot is turned off. Therefore, the network sharing is managed and controlled as a whole to prevent the sharing of excess and bring losses to the user.

参见图2,提出本发明基于无线热点的网络分享方法第二实施例,本实施例以设置最大使用流量作为使用限制条件为例,所述方法包括以下步骤:Referring to FIG. 2, a second embodiment of a wireless hotspot-based network sharing method according to the present invention is provided. In this embodiment, a maximum usage traffic is set as a usage restriction condition, and the method includes the following steps:
S21、对接入设备设置最大使用流量。S21. Set a maximum usage traffic for the access device.
S22、监控接入无线热点的接入设备的使用流量。判断接入设备的使用流量是否达到最大使用流量,当达到最大使用流量时,执行步骤S23。S22. Monitor usage traffic of the access device that accesses the wireless hotspot. It is determined whether the usage traffic of the access device reaches the maximum usage traffic. When the maximum usage traffic is reached, step S23 is performed.
S23、断开接入设备与无线热点的连接。S23. Disconnect the access device from the wireless hotspot.
例如,终端A开启无线热点,当终端B、C、D连接无线热点时或连 接无线热点后,终端A分别对终端B、C、D设置最大使用流量为30M、35M、50M。在网络分享过程中,终端A分别对终端B、C、D的使用流量进行监控,当终端B的使用流量达到30M时,终端A则断开终端B与无线热点的连接,禁止终端B继续分享网络;终端C和D的使用流量没有达到各自的最大使用流量,则不受影响,继续分享网络。For example, terminal A turns on a wireless hotspot, and when terminals B, C, and D connect to a wireless hotspot, or even After receiving the wireless hotspot, terminal A sets the maximum usage traffic for terminals B, C, and D to 30M, 35M, and 50M, respectively. During the network sharing process, terminal A monitors the usage traffic of terminals B, C, and D. When the usage traffic of terminal B reaches 30M, terminal A disconnects the connection between terminal B and the wireless hotspot, and prohibits terminal B from continuing to share. Network; if the usage traffic of terminals C and D does not reach their maximum usage traffic, they will not be affected and continue to share the network.
又如,终端A开启无线热点,当终端B、C、D连接无线热点前或连接无线热点后,终端A对终端B、C、D平均分配使用流量,统一设置最大使用流量为50M。在网络分享过程中,终端A分别对终端B、C、D的使用流量进行监控,当终端C的使用流量达到50M时,终端A则断开终端C与无线热点的连接,禁止终端C继续分享网络;终端B和D的使用流量没有达到50M,则不受影响,继续分享网络。For example, terminal A turns on the wireless hotspot. When the terminals B, C, and D are connected to the wireless hotspot or connected to the wireless hotspot, the terminal A allocates the traffic to the terminals B, C, and D, and uniformly sets the maximum used traffic to 50M. In the network sharing process, terminal A monitors the usage traffic of terminals B, C, and D respectively. When the usage traffic of terminal C reaches 50M, terminal A disconnects the connection between terminal C and the wireless hotspot, and prohibits terminal C from continuing to share. Network; if the usage traffic of terminals B and D does not reach 50M, it will not be affected and continue to share the network.
